About Nick Jonsson: Nick Jonsson, widely recognized as the World’s #1 Thought Leader on Executive Loneliness, is an award-winning speaker, bestselling author, and transformational coach ranked among the Top 3 Coaches Worldwide by SpeakIn in 2025. He is a Certified Master Coach and Professional Certified Coach with multiple accreditations, specializing in Executive, Life, Team, and Sober Coaching. His journey from corporate success through loneliness and burnout to recovery is captured in his bestselling book Executive Loneliness and reflected in his founding of peer and men’s groups. A top 2% Ironman triathlete and honored mental health campaigner, Nick empowers leaders globally to turn isolation into authentic growth.In this episode, Gary and Nick Jonsson discuss:Climbing the corporate ladder and realizing success can feel emptyIsolation, silence, and avoidance during personal and professional crisesRecovery from addiction and rediscovering purpose through support systemsThe power of empathy and connection in transforming lives and leadershipKey Takeaways:Chasing professional success without vulnerability or honest conversations can lead to destructive isolation, so it’s critical to build trusted relationships and openly share struggles before they spiral.Ignoring emotional pain often manifests in physical or behavioral breakdowns, and recognizing those warning signs early is a chance to intervene and seek help instead of letting them escalate.Joining supportive communities and practicing accountability not only accelerates recovery from addiction or burnout but also normalizes the journey and shows that growth is possible for anyone.Turning personal adversity into purpose-driven action, such as advocacy or mentoring, can transform painful experiences into meaningful impact while also sustaining long-term fulfillment.
